Alexandrov Fired, Grebyonkin Named Successor

Alexandrov Fired, Grebyonkin Named Successor

Alexander Alexandrov will be replaced by Yevgeniy Grebyonkin as head coach of the Russian senior women’s team following a coaches’ meeting on Monday, newsagency Rsport reports. Alexandrov lead the Russian women to their first world team title since independence in 2010 as well as the …

Gafuik to represent Canada in London

Nathan Gafuik (CAN)

National champion Nathan Gafuik has earned the nomination to represent Canada at this summer’s Olympic Games in London.
After the Canadian men failed to qualify a complete team, criteria based on results at National Championships and Challenger Cup events in Osijek, Maribor, and Ghent were set …

Wammes out of Olympic fight

Wammes out of Olympic fight

Jeffrey Wammes’ fight for selection for the single Dutch spot at this summer’s Olympic Games appears to have ended following an injury at last week’s Maribor Challenge Cup.
Earlier this year, Wammes sued the Dutch gymnastics federation (KNGU) after it nominated Epke Zonderland for the position.

Jordan Jovtchev questionable for London

Jordan Jovtchev (BUL)

Bulgarian press reports today that Jordan Jovtchev, top gymnast of the country and president of the Bulgarian Gymnastics Federation, might be unable to participate at the London Olympics due to injury.
Jovtchev qualified to the Olympics at the Visa International Gymnastics Test Event this past January, …
